A Conversation: Making Art During COVID

05/23/2022 @ 5:30 pm - 7:30 pm

Join us for a look behind the curtain at Illinois Youth Center – Chicago.

Throughout the pandemic, we kept all of our programs going. Curious to know how we did it?

Our ally, Michael Byrd, Assistant Superintendent of Programs, and our program leaders, Mbali Guliwe and Tanji Harper, will lead a discussion about the Firewriters program for boys at IYC-Chicago during COVID.

Enjoy hors d’oeuvres and a cash bar while learning about some of the challenges and extraordinary triumphs of the past two years. (Each guest will receive a coupon for one free drink on us.)

We hope you can join us in person at the intimate Venus Cabaret Theater space in the Mercury Theater, located at 3745 N Southport – but if you can’t, we invite you to join us on Zoom.
